The significance of easily locating qualified prescribers is paramount in addressing the opioid crisis. Timely access to appropriate medication, combined with counseling and behavioral therapies, dramatically improves treatment outcomes. Historically, barriers to accessing these treatments, including geographical limitations and lack of awareness, have hindered efforts to combat opioid addiction. Simplifying the process of finding suitable medical professionals offers a crucial pathway to recovery and reduces the risk of relapse and overdose.
